One of the most compelling reasons to choose a chain link fence, especially one at a height of 3 feet, is its durability. Crafted from galvanized steel, this type of fence is resistant to rust and corrosion, ensuring longevity. With the right maintenance, a 3-foot chain link fence can withstand various weather conditions, from rain to snow, making it a reliable choice for year-round use.

Gabions are rectangular or box-like structures made of steel wire mesh filled with stones, rocks, or other materials. They are commonly used for erosion control, retaining walls, riverbank stabilization, and decorative landscaping. The wire mesh itself is often galvanized or coated to resist corrosion, ensuring longevity and durability even in harsh weather conditions.
